Ilsanseo District () is a district in Goyang, Gyeonggi-do, South Korea. Ilsan-gu was divided into Ilsandong District and Ilsanseo District on May 16, 2005.
It is a district located in the western part of Goyang-si, Gyeonggi-do. It has an area of 42.15 km<sup>2</sup> and is divided into Ilsandong-gu to the east and Ilsanseo-gu to the west, centered on Gobong-ro, which connects Jungsan and Hosu Park. It borders Paju-si to the north and Gimpo-si to the west across the Han River.

Ilsanseo District has 46 schools including: 22 elementary schools, 12 middle schools, 9 high schools, and 2 special schools.
Hugok () is notable for their hagwons (ÃÂÂìÂÂ, "cram school"), and many hagwons are present in the region.
